Quantum‑Inspired AI Promises Better Cancer Outcomes
The University of Utah’s latest research investigates how quantum‑mechanics concepts can be integrated into artificial intelligence (AI) systems to advance cancer care. By applying quantum‑inspired algorithms, the team hopes to develop AI models that more accurately predict tumor behavior, personalize treatment plans, and ultimately improve patient outcomes.
While the article does not detail specific experimental results, it highlights the potential of combining quantum theory with machine learning to tackle complex medical challenges. The approach could lead to more precise diagnostics and better therapeutic strategies, representing a promising intersection of physics, AI, and oncology.
